The Slovakia Digital Payment Market was estimated at USD 366 Million in 2025 and is projected to reach USD 492 Million by 2032, growing at a CAGR of 5.1% from 2026 to 2032.
The Slovakia Digital Payment Market is undergoing a notable transformation, fueled by the widespread adoption of smartphones and the Internet. As consumers increasingly favor digital solutions for their convenience and security, the sector is rapidly evolving to meet this demand.
With the government's initiatives to promote digitalization, we see an upward trend in contactless payments, mobile wallets, and online banking. However, while the growth trajectory appears promising, challenges such as data privacy concerns must be addressed to ensure sustained market expansion.

Despite the market's growth potential, several restraints hinder its progress. A prevalent cash-centric culture among the population poses a barrier to widespread digital payment adoption. Additionally, low consumer awareness regarding the benefits of digital payment options affects their trust and acceptance.
Small businesses often lack the infrastructure and resources to implement digital payment solutions, further contributing to limited market penetration. Finally, security concerns related to data breaches and cyber fraud can deter consumers from fully embracing these technologies.
The digital payment landscape in Slovakia is increasingly characterized by the rise of mobile payment solutions and contactless transactions. As consumers embrace the convenience of digital wallets and payment apps, businesses are adapting by integrating online payment options to meet customer expectations.
The popularity of peer-to-peer payment platforms continues to grow, driven by social interactions and e-commerce. on top of that, the integration of biometric authentication technologies is enhancing security, making digital payments more appealing to users.
Investment opportunities in the Slovakia Digital Payment Market are plentiful, particularly in mobile payment platforms and e-wallet services. The demand for contactless technologies is rising, offering attractive avenues for businesses to explore.
Fintech firms providing innovative solutions, such as peer-to-peer transfers and mobile banking, are well-positioned for growth. Additionally, there is a pressing need for advancements in cybersecurity solutions to bolster consumer confidence in digital transactions.
The Slovakian government is actively fostering the growth of the digital payment market through various initiatives. By adopting regulations such as the EU's Payment Services Directive 2 (PSD2), the government aims to enhance online transaction security and consumer protection.
Looking ahead to 2026-2032, the Slovakia Digital Payment Market is expected to thrive. Factors such as increasing internet penetration, a surge in smartphone usage, and a shift toward cashless transactions will drive this growth.
The government’s proactive stance on digital payment promotion will further enhance market conditions. As consumers and businesses increasingly seek efficient and secure payment solutions, the market is set to become more innovative and competitive.
